Bird a week 21/52 - Birdie Brooch


This week it is a brooch! I don't make a lot of brooches but I enjoyed this one and people have been asking for them so watch this space!

I made a paper texture using my friend Lynne Glazzard' s technique and then added one thin layer of enamel to the fine silver (Art Clay silver) brooch. Quite tricky to photograph but it has a lovely subtle look to it.

On the back I made a brooch pin in sterling silver wire which I soldered on after enamelling. Thank you Nic on PMC Tips blog for the idea. I am quite pleased with how it turned out so I am feeling inspired to make more :)

Friday 13 May 2011

Bird A Week 19/52 - Sitting Pretty Too


Yay - this week I am on time with my bird!

I really enjoyed making this one. I shaped some cork clay into a bird form and then painted layers of Art Clay Silver paste to create a hollow bead birdie. I just build up extra layers to for the wings. I had some paste which was quite lumpy so I just went with it and actually I do like the effect it gave with just a little smoothing out.


As there is no back to this piece as such you have to have a photo of the rear end instead!  ;-)

I have not yet decided what to make it into. Possibly a pendant but I am thinking maybe a brooch.
